I remember cleaning out that passage and the holes in the heads that were plugged with carbon on my '69 Coronet 318.
I used a chisel to turn the screws out, it was pretty easy.
After the heat crossover was cleaned out, the choke and carb worked way better when the engine was cold, the stumble disappeared entirely which made the car much better to drive especially when it was -30 below F.
